G
Geegi Wkiju Review of Ostrich Convenience Store
Ostrich Convenience Store is a hidden gem! They ha...
Ostrich Convenience Store is a hidden gem! They have a great selection of products and the prices are unbeatable. The staff is always friendly and provides great customer service. I highly recommend shopping at Ostrich Convenience Store!

Comments: